|
登录后可查看完整内容和下载
您需要 登录 才可以下载或查看,没有帐号?立即注册
x
本帖最后由 b5888000 于 2025-2-26 09:05 编辑
问题描述:ASP1.8合击版本,想在人物被杀后花元宝进行原地复活,一直调用不到@原地复活,大侠们帮忙看下,是哪里出问题了吗?[@PlayDie]
#If
KillByHum
#Act
CALCVAR HUMAN 被杀数 + 1
SAVEVAR HUMAN 被杀数 ..\QuestDiary\数据文件\被杀.txt
#CALL [\\登陆\封号.txt] @FH
SendMsg 1 [<$KILLER>]在%m把[<$USERNAME>]杀害了.兄弟们帮忙打个120看能否抢救 250 0
SendMsg 1 [<$KILLER>]在%m把[<$USERNAME>]杀害了.兄弟们帮忙打个120看能否抢救 250 0
#ElseAct
SendMsg 1 凶残的[<$MONKILLER>]在%m把[<$USERNAME>]给分尸了!! 250 0
SendMsg 1 凶残的[<$MONKILLER>]在%m把[<$USERNAME>]给分尸了!! 250 0
Close
上面是原脚本内容,都正常。
------------------------------------------------------------------------------------------------------------------
下面加了原地复活脚本,但一直调用不到@原地复活
[@PlayDie]
#If
KillByHum
#Act
CALCVAR HUMAN 被杀数 + 1
SAVEVAR HUMAN 被杀数 ..\QuestDiary\数据文件\被杀.txt
#CALL [\\登陆\封号.txt] @FH
SendMsg 1 [<$KILLER>]在%m把[<$USERNAME>]杀害了.兄弟们帮忙打个120看能否抢救 250 0
SendMsg 1 [<$KILLER>]在%m把[<$USERNAME>]杀害了.兄弟们帮忙打个120看能否抢救 250 0
; 添加付费原地复活选项
#If
CheckGameGold > 199
#Act
#say 你想花费200元宝原地复活吗?\点击确定复活! <确定/@原地复活> <取消/@Exit>
Close
#Elsesay
你没有足够的元宝进行原地复活!
Close
#ElseAct
SendMsg 1 凶残的[<$MONKILLER>]在%m把[<$USERNAME>]给分尸了!! 250 0
SendMsg 1 凶残的[<$MONKILLER>]在%m把[<$USERNAME>]给分尸了!! 250 0
Close
[@原地复活]
#If
CheckGameGold > 199
#Act
GameGold - 200 ;点了原地复活后,元宝都不会减,应该都没执行到这一步。
Revive ;ASP引擎这个命令报错,目前都执行不到这一步,不知道复活用什么命令,请教下大佬
SendMsg 6 你已经成功花费200元宝原地复活!
Close
#ElseAct
SendMsg 6 你没有足够的元宝进行原地复活!
Close
哪位大佬帮忙分析下,是什么原因?谢谢了
我知道答案
回答被采纳将会获得
3 金币
已有0人回答
|
|